Lipid profile status in chronic obstructive pulmonary disease patients with acute exacerbation and its correlation with the severity and treatment of the disease presenting at a tertiary hospital in Nepal

Abstract

Introduction: Most of the morbidity and mortality in chronic obstructive pulmonary dsease patients is due to extra-pulmonary complications, especially cardiovascular complications for which dyslipidemia is a major risk factor. So, the aim of our study was to correlate dyslipidemia with the severity of acute exacerbations of COPD.

Method: A hospital-based, prospective, cross-sectional study of 6 months' duration was conducted among 150 COPD patients presenting with acute exacerbation. Ethical approval was obtained from the Institutional Review Committee of the Institute of Medicine. Various study variables (Age, sex, ethnicity, BMI, dyspnea grading, and severity of COPD presentation) were recorded. Fasting lipid profile was analyzed and correlated with disease severity.

Result: The majority of patients were aged over 70 years (ranging from 42 to 83 years, with a mean age of 69.9 +/-9.5 years), were female (86, 57.3%), and belonged to the Brahmin ethnicity (60, 40%). Most of them presented in exacerbation with Dyspnea (MMRC grade III), 87 (58%), with a mean body mass index of 26.90 kg/m². On our evaluation, the median triglyceride, total cholesterol, high-density lipoprotein cholesterol, and low-density lipoprotein cholesterol were found to be 140.22, 127.71, 38.7, 120; 175.28, 166.41, 30.24, 147.06; and 192.81, 183.83, 23.22, 158.67 mg/dl in moderate, severe, and very severe AECOPD cases, respectively.

Conclusion: Greater severity of exacerbations was associated with higher values of atherogenic lipid parameters (TC, TGs, and LDL) and lower HDL levels.
